MINORS: The Eyes Have It—Michael Harris

High-A is new to me. After over a decade covering minor league prospects at several different levels, including a few lower levels no longer in existence, I finally scouted a High-A game for the first time on 5/18. Rome (Braves), formerly of the South Atlantic League (Low-A), is now apart of the High-A East South division. Since Rome is one of two home parks for me, High-A baseball is now a part of my live coverage.

Thus far, High-A live look coverage has been spotty. I had two opportunities to catch Bowling Green (High-A Rays) vs. Rome. My two main road targets, Greg Jones (SS, TAM) and Blake Hunt (C, TAM), sat out one of the two games I worked during their week in town.
